What are the short tent pole looking segments at the bottom of the pack attached to the ice ax loops for?

On this pack you hang the ice axe(s) upside down so the head is below the bottom loop. You use the shaft to loop through the hole in the axe head from the bottom up (and from rear to front) and then use the bottom strap to tighten the axe and shaft together. That way your axe doesn't slip out of the loops.
